vue.js 如何设置Chart.js日期标签的区域设置?

j8ag8udp  于 2022-11-17  发布在  Vue.js
关注(0)|答案(1)|浏览(166)

我有一个Vue组件,它使用Chart.js呈现不同的图表。一切都很好,但是我不能为X轴上的日期标签设置区域设置。
我尝试在vue-component的script部分的顶部定义moment locale,但是没有任何结果。

<script>
    import * as moment from 'moment';
    import 'moment/locale/ru';
    moment.locale('ru');

    console.log(moment.locale()); // it shows needle language: 'ru'!

    import Chart from 'chart.js';

    export default { ... this.chart = new Chart(this.context, config); ... };
</script>

^不过......这一试之后我在X轴上看到:2013年7月,2013年8月,而不是2013年。
谁遇到过这样的问题,你是怎么解决的?来人啊,帮帮忙🤞🏻

tf7tbtn2

tf7tbtn21#

"我已经解决了"
您应该使用此适配器https://github.com/chartjs/chartjs-adapter-date-fns来转换图表上的月份。

相关问题